Types of Auto Insurance
Auto insurance is a type of coverage that provides financial protection against losses resulting from accidents and other related events. It is important to note that auto insurance is not a one-size-fits-all product, and there are various types of coverage available to a car owner.
Liability Insurance: Liability insurance is the most basic and usually required type of auto insurance. It covers the costs associated with damage or injury caused to another party in an accident caused by the policyholder. This coverage may include medical expenses, property damage, and legal fees that may result from an at-fault incident.
Collision Insurance: Collision insurance covers the cost of repair or replacement for damage caused to the policyholder’s vehicle as a result of an accident. This coverage may also include repairs for damage caused by an object striking the vehicle, such as a tree or fence.
Comprehensive Insurance: Comprehensive insurance is an optional type of coverage which can provide protection against damage caused by events other than a collision. This could include theft, vandalism, and weather-related damage, among other events.
Personal Injury Protection (PIP) Insurance: PIP insurance provides coverage for medical and hospital expenses for the policyholder, as well as any passengers who are injured in an accident. This type of insurance may also cover lost wages and funeral expenses.
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ist Coverage: Uninsured/Underinsured motorist coverage provides protection in the event that the policyholder is involved in an accident with an uninsured or underinsured driver. This coverage can provide coverage for damages, medical expenses, and legal fees that may result from an accident.
It is important to understand the different types of auto insurance coverage available, as well as the coverage and benefits of each type. It is also important to consider the amount of coverage that is necessary, and to ensure that the policy purchased provides adequate protection.
Factors that Affect Auto Insurance Rates
1. Age: Generally, younger drivers are considered as a high-risk driver due to their lack of driving experience, which can result in higher auto insurance rates for them. Many insurance companies also offer discounts for drivers age 50 and above, as they are considered to have more experience and a better driving record.
2. Driving History: Drivers with a history of traffic violations, such as speeding, DUI’s, and reckless driving, can expect to pay higher rates for their auto insurance. Conversely, drivers who have a clean driving record may be eligible for discounts or lower rates.
3. Vehicle Type: The type of vehicle being insured can have an impact on auto insurance rates. Luxury vehicles are generally more expensive to insure due to their higher replacement cost, while older vehicles may be cheaper to insure due to their lower replacement cost.
4. Location: Where the vehicle is registered and primarily used can also affect auto insurance rates. If the vehicle is registered in an area with a high rate of auto thefts or accidents, the insurance rates may be higher than if the vehicle was registered in an area with a low rate of auto thefts or accidents.
5. Credit Score: Some insurance companies take a driver’s credit score into consideration when setting auto insurance rates. Generally, drivers with a higher credit score may be eligible for lower rates, while drivers with a lower credit score may be charged higher rates.
In order to lower their auto insurance rates, drivers should make sure to maintain a clean driving record, shop around for the best rates, and consider raising their deductible. Drivers should also consider taking a defensive driving course, which can result in a discount on their auto insurance premiums. Furthermore, drivers should make sure to compare different insurance companies in order to find the best rates. Finally, drivers should consider bundling their auto insurance with other types of insurance, such as homeowners or renters insurance, as this can result in lower rates.

Understanding Auto Insurance Policy
Auto insurance policy is a contract between an insurance company and an individual or business, which protects the policyholder against financial loss in the event of an accident or other incident involving a vehicle. This policy will cover the cost of any damages to the vehicle, as well as any medical expenses that may be incurred as a result of injuries sustained in the accident. It will also cover any liability costs that may arise, should the policyholder be found to be at fault for the accident.
There are several key terms and conditions that are associated with an auto insurance policy. These include deductibles, limits, and exclusions.
Deductibles are the amount that an individual must pay out of pocket before the insurance will kick in to cover any costs associated with an accident or other incident. The higher the deductible, the lower the insurance premiums will be.
Limits are the maximum amount of coverage that an auto insurance policy will provide. This amount is based on the type of vehicle, the age of the vehicle, the driver’s record, and other factors.
Exclusions refer to any incident or situation in which the insurance policy will not cover any costs associated with the incident. Examples of common exclusions include incidents involving other drivers not listed on the policy, incidents involving uninsured drivers, and incidents involving drivers under the influence of drugs or alcohol.
It is important to understand the terms and conditions of an auto insurance policy before signing on the dotted line. These terms and conditions can determine the level of coverage and protection that an individual will have in the event of an accident or other incident.
